Embarking on a journey towards web development mastery requires more than just learning a few languages; it demands a structured plan. Initially, focus on foundational elements like HTML, CSS, and JavaScript – these are your core foundations. Subsequently, delve into server-side technologies such as Python and databases such as MySQL or PostgreSQ